When Taylor Swift released her album Midnights in late 2022, I don’t think she expected the first track, “Lavender Haze,” to inspire one of 2023’s biggest color trends. “Digital lavender” has officially been named by trend forecasting website WSGN—along with its sister company Coloro—as 2023’s color of the year, and it’s already one of winter 2023’s key fashion trends. Ahead, we spoke to trend forecasting experts about how to shop and style digital lavender for the year ahead, including a few on-trend items broken down by category to make shopping just a little easier. 

While Barbiecore pink—which was first spotted on the Valentino Fall/Winter 2022 runway before spreading to just about every corner of the fashion and beauty worlds last year—was all about maximalism after years spent in loungewear sets and leggings, this new trendy color brings a serene touch to our wardrobes for the year ahead. “Digital lavender is a color full of hope and positivity,” says Clare Smith, (opens in new tab) a Colour Strategist at WGSN. “It’s a shade that poses that much-needed cautious optimism and escapism that people are craving post-pandemic and even in times of budget crunch; it is imaginative and creative but also speaks of serenity and balance.”
